摘 要:振幅整合脑电图(aEEG)通过单通道系统连续监测大脑电活动,用于加强神经功能监测,反映脑功能情况。aEEG因其操作简单,方便床边监测,在临床上很适合应用于新生儿这一特殊群体评估脑功能及其预后。目前在新生儿病房aEEG主要用于评估足月儿缺氧缺血性脑病及癫痫的预后和早产儿脑室内出血及脑室周围白质软化的预后。该文对aEEG原理、判读方法、临床意义、局限性及未来可能发展方向而进行简要综述。Amplitude-integrated electroencephalogram( aEEG) is a kind of simplified graphic,used to strengthen the neural function monitoring,which can reflect the state of brain function through continuously monitoring brain electrical activity. aEEG,because of its simple operation and convenient bedside monitoring, is regarded as a suitable tool to evaluate neonatal brain function and prognosis in clinical. Currently,aEEG is mainly used for evaluating the prognosis of hypoxic-ischemic encephalopathy and seizures of full term,also periventricular leukomalacia and intraventricular hemorrhage in preterm neonates. Here is to make a review of the aEEG principle,interpretation methods,clinical implications,limitations and possible future development directions.
